    John Palmer's life will hang in the balance on Home and Away as he suffers a brain injury in dramatic scenes.

    The frightening moment takes place on what should be a romantic day for the Summer Bay favourite, as his wife Marilyn (Emily Symons) takes him out for a surprise boat trip and picnic lunch.

    With this being Home and Away, though, it was never going to pass by peacefully without some incident or another, was it?

    The drama kicks off when John tries to leap over a rail to board the boat, keen to impress Marilyn with a reminder of his navy days.

    Sadly for John, he isn't quite as athletic as he used to be, so he ends up falling and banging his head on the bottom of the boat.

    Shane Withington, who plays John, told TV Week: "Marilyn takes him on a boat, thinking he'll enjoy it because of his navy background.

    "He says to Marilyn: 'Let me show you how we do things in the navy'. But as he leaps over the rail to get on the boat, he mistimes things and hits his head on the bottom of the boat."

    Although John seems fine once he regains consciousness, he agrees to get himself checked out at the hospital as a precaution.

    This turns out to be a wise move, as doctor Nate Cooper warns that John has a bleed on the brain as a result of his accident and it could be fatal.

    As Marilyn despairs, what does the future hold for her and John?

    Home and Away airs these scenes next week in Australia and early November on Channel 5 in the UK.
